Some people are really into exercise. They love to work up a sweat, go on a run, or lift weights. I hate all of it. And I know I’m not alone in that. But the fact of the matter is that we really need to exercise. We can’t hire someone to work out for us. It’s something we have to do for ourselves. In Philippians 2:12–13, the apostle Paul addresses a similar spiritual reality.
Paul was in prison in Rome when he wrote the words in today's text. He was experiencing anxiety over the fact that he was separated from his fellow believers, whom he cared so much about.
Effectively Paul was saying, “Look, guys, I cannot be with you right now. I wish I were there to offer you guidance and to be a good example for you, but I cannot do it. But don’t forget: It is God who works in you, and not Paul.”
